My son slipped in a coma and was paralyzed from complication with the flu. He went to DeVry University and I paid them with proof of the canceled checks.
The school that was sued kept our settlement agreement portion and reported the loan as owed. I couldn't keep calling them or writing letters with no end. I filed for bankruptcy in 2019 and went before the judge because of our circumstances it was discharged. Devry University, Nelnet, and U.S.
Department of Education was notified by the court and myself several ways and time to include credit disputes, certified letters, CFPB complaints, uploaded documents and hiring credit correction agencies. Come to find out they didn't correctly document one of the loans.
It has cost me thousands and thousands, my credit scores have suffered regardless of other on time payments for credit cards and loans. They transferred to Mohela after the bankruptcy and permanent disability discharge.
- Ruining my life
Preferred solution: For them to correct their records and contact their servicer. The loans wasn't closed or transferred it was discharged in 2019.

There are two ways I know of to receive forgiveness, economic hardship or disability; I qualified under both and 3-4 years ago I received forgiveness through NELNET. It's called Student Loan Offset.
